Karun Nair's Resurgence in the Vijay Hazare Trophy: A Case for National Call-Up
Karun Nair, the Indian cricketer who once made headlines with a historic triple century in Test cricket, has once again proven his mettle in the ongoing Vijay Hazare Trophy. His impressive performances have caught the eye of national selectors, raising the possibility of his return to the Indian team.
Background
Nair, 31, made his Test debut for India in 2016 and became an instant sensation when he scored 303 not out against England at the M.A. Chidambaram Stadium in Chennai. He went on to represent India in 6 Tests and 12 ODIs but has struggled to maintain his place in the team since.
Vijay Hazare Trophy Dominance
In the current Vijay Hazare Trophy, Nair has been in exceptional form, leading his side Karnataka to the semifinals. He has scored 418 runs in 7 innings, averaging 69.67. His batting has been characterized by its solidity, composure, and ability to anchor the innings.
National Team Recall Potential
Nair's recent performances have put him back in the reckoning for a national call-up. With India's Test batting lineup facing some uncertainty, Nair could potentially be considered for the upcoming series against Australia and Sri Lanka. His experience and ability to play long innings could be valuable assets for the team.

Despite being one of the top batsmen in the world, Babar Azam has been struggling to score a century in international cricket for the past 83 innings. His struggle continued in the first ODI against Sri Lanka, where he could only manage 29 runs off 51 deliveries before being dismissed. This dismal performance raises concerns for Pakistan as their captain's ODI average in the last six innings is only 13.83 with a strike rate of 61.94. With the pressure of being the captain and the expectations of his fans, Azam needs to break his century drought to regain his form and confidence.

Pakistani cricket star Babar Azam reaches a major milestone in his career as he becomes the fifth player from his country to score 15000 runs in international cricket. Despite failing to lead his team to a victory in the series decider against South Africa, Babar achieved this feat in the ninth over of the match. With this, he joins the ranks of renowned Pakistani cricketers such as Inzamam-ul-Haq, Younis Khan, Mohammad Yousuf, and Javed Miandad.

The iconic JLN Stadium in New Delhi, built for the 1982 Asian Games, will be demolished to make way for a state-of-the-art Sports City. The project will also include residential facilities for athletes. While no timeline has been set for the project, the government is studying models from around the world to create a world-class sporting infrastructure. Meanwhile, the Sports Authority of India is taking steps to enhance the sports culture in the country by recruiting 320 coaches for various disciplines.
